tinySA/demos/ARMCM3-STM32F103-FATFS-GCC
gdisirio db7b60f402 Modified all the halconf.h files to include the USB and Serial over USB drivers.
git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@2753 35acf78f-673a-0410-8e92-d51de3d6d3f4
2011-02-20 15:26:43 +00:00
..
Makefile git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@2376 35acf78f-673a-0410-8e92-d51de3d6d3f4 2010-11-17 08:06:33 +00:00
ch.ld git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@1948 35acf78f-673a-0410-8e92-d51de3d6d3f4 2010-05-22 09:07:50 +00:00
chconf.h Fixed typo in configuration files. 2010-12-02 17:40:37 +00:00
halconf.h Modified all the halconf.h files to include the USB and Serial over USB drivers. 2011-02-20 15:26:43 +00:00
main.c git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@2595 35acf78f-673a-0410-8e92-d51de3d6d3f4 2011-01-06 10:56:51 +00:00
mcuconf.h Updated the mcuconf.h file in the STM32 demos to include the USB parameters. 2011-02-20 15:13:14 +00:00
readme.txt git-svn-id: svn://svn.code.sf.net/p/chibios/svn/trunk@1915 35acf78f-673a-0410-8e92-d51de3d6d3f4 2010-05-13 14:02:17 +00:00

readme.txt

This file contains invisible Unicode characters!

This file contains invisible Unicode characters that may be processed differently from what appears below. If your use case is intentional and legitimate, you can safely ignore this warning. Use the Escape button to reveal hidden characters.

*****************************************************************************
** ChibiOS/RT port for ARM-Cortex-M3 STM32F103.                            **
*****************************************************************************

** TARGET **

The demo runs on an Olimex STM32-P103 board.

** The Demo **

This demo shows how to integrate the FatFs file system and use the SPI and MMC
drivers.
The demo flashes the board LED using a thread and monitors the MMC slot for
a card insertion. When a card is inserted then the file system is mounted
and the LED flashes faster.
A command line shell is spawned on SD2, all the interaction with the demo is
performed using the command shell, type "help" for a list of the available
commands.

** Build Procedure **

The demo has been tested by using the free Codesourcery GCC-based toolchain,
YAGARTO and an experimental WinARM build including GCC 4.3.0.
Just modify the TRGT line in the makefile in order to use different GCC ports.

** Notes **

Some files used by the demo are not part of ChibiOS/RT but are copyright of
ST Microelectronics and are licensed under a different license.
Also note that not all the files present in the ST library are distributed
with ChibiOS/RT, you can find the whole library on the ST web site:

                             http://www.st.com